Too much talk about their looks.
A lot of people have made comments that Sutter wasn't handsome enough, or that Shailene was too pretty to be a "quiet nerd" type who didn't get attention from boys.
Yes, physical attractiveness has importance in what kind of attention you get. But how you present yourself, and your personality, has WAY more importance. Sutter wasn't really handsome, but he was loud, outgoing, and apparently had a lot of charisma. I personally found him extremely off-putting, but for a large amount of high schoolers, his personality was appealing.
Aimee was quiet, self-deprecating, and didn't take much pride in her appearance. Her personality and interests would not have made her a popular girl in high school culture.
Maybe I understand this because I was an "Aimee" type, to a degree, in high school. I started wearing nicer clothes and styling my hair my senior year, and people considered me physically attractive. However, I was not popular. I was never asked out by guys in my high school. I was respected for being good at school and accomplished, but I never would have been popular in the prom queen/athlete way. Not by a long shot.
